Yes, He does! The Bible says, “For God so loved the world that He gave His only begotten Son, that whoever believes in Him should not perish but have everlasting life” (John 3:16). God’s love for the world compelled His response to humanity’s greatest problem—sin—and its consequences. According to the scriptures, sin is unrighteousness, and sin is the breaking of God’s law. The Bible goes on to say, “all have sinned and fall short of the glory of God” (Romans 3:23). It also says, “there is none righteous, no, not one” (Romans 3:10). However, in spite of these realities, the love of God did not give up on mankind.

God made the first and the greatest move toward humanity. God sent His Son Jesus Christ to bear and pay the penalty of our sins by offering up His life by dying on the cross of Calvary two thousand years ago. By believing on Him—trusting Him—we can obtain forgiveness of ALL our sins, and not have to face their eternal consequences. The Bible says, “the wages [consequences] of sin is death”—not just physical death, but an utter and everlasting separation from God in a terrible place called Hell, where all sinners experience the unmitigated, unending judgment of God—“but the gift of God is eternal life in Christ Jesus our Lord” (Romans 6:23).

The truth is that God loves you and wants to forgive ALL your sins. He desires to have a living, active relationship with you, and He wants to grant you everlasting life instead of everlasting judgment. All you need to do is to receive His love for you, acknowledge that you are a sinner, and place your trust in Jesus and His sufficient payment for sin on your behalf. If you can believe these truths in your heart, then proceed to verbally invite Jesus into your heart and life. You can do it today, even right now! “For with the heart one believes unto righteousness, and with the mouth confession is made unto salvation” (Romans 10:10).
